Output 516656d73f6779ca1a453ade8312365e36ff45f3523118109136de6d2a5308e5:3

value
3228422
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2db653ae2c19edb95bbc863331f634d5d7676a9c OP_EQUALVERIFY OP_CHECKSIG
address
15AhpvhVtyfCbCEHviKPuEt6gZGXCN9VvD
transaction
516656d73f6779ca1a453ade8312365e36ff45f3523118109136de6d2a5308e5
spent
true